For single-electron atom/ions the energy of an orbital is entirely dependent upon its principal quantum number, but in multi--electron atoms/ions the energy depends upon the principal as well as azimuthal quantum number. when two or more orbitals have the same energy, they are called degenerates. To compare the energies of different orbitals in multi--electron atoms/ions we have two rules :
1) The more the value of (n+l), the more is the energy.
2) When two orbitals have the same value of (n+l) the energy is decided by the principal quantum number, i.e., more the principal quantum number, the more is the energy.
